FieldAware Recognized in the 2016 Gartner Magic Quadrant for Field Service Management

Understanding Field Service Maturity and Enabling Business Growth

Business arrow increase of success graph and growth stock market earnings financial on profit income background with diagram chart investment.

FieldAware, the leader in made-for-mobile, cloud-based field service automation solutions today announced it has been positioned on the November 2016 Magic Quadrant for Field Service Management by Gartner, the world’s leading information technology research and advisory company.

The Field Service Management (FSM) Magic Quadrant recognizes companies based on criteria which includes their ability to execute and the completeness of their vision.

“We are delighted to be recognized in Gartner’s FSM Magic Quadrant for the first time,” said Steve Mason, CRO of FieldAware. “We believe we have focused on bringing a new, dynamic edge to field service, so to be recognized in the Gartner Magic Quadrant is fantastic.

“Our goal is to simplify field service management. We want businesses to get the most value out of our solution, quickly, without having to worry about lengthy implementation and adoption. Our mobility and integration capabilities have been instrumental in our momentum and we believe that Gartner’s recognition is further proof of our approach.”
